>>>>> Reiner Steib wrote:
> On Thu, Oct 16 2008, Katsumi Yamaoka wrote:
>> Note that adding (utf8 . utf-8) to `mm-charset-synonym-alist'
>> causes the same problem (I verified it with Emacs 22.3).

> I'm surprised that `mm-charset-synonym-alist' has any effect on
> outgoing messages.  I though it would only be used when displaying an
> article.  Could you please investigate this?

That is due to `mml-generate-mime-1' that uses the charset specified
as is (for encoding, it uses the valid coding system derived from
that charset according to `mm-charset-synonym-alist', though).
It's a bug, I have two solutions, and I like the second one:

1. Bind `mm-charset-synonym-alist' (and `mm-charset-eval-alist')
   to nil when encoding.  And signal an error if the charset is
   invalid.

2. Replace the charset that is an alias with the valid one that
   Emacs knows.  Although it violates the idea that "the charset
   aliases would be used only when displaying an article", it
   will be convenience for users.

WDYT?  The patches for 1. and 2. are below:

Patch1:
--8<---------------cut here---------------start------------->8---
--- mml.el~	2008-10-03 05:47:11 +0000
+++ mml.el	2008-10-20 23:58:29 +0000
@@ -476,8 +476,11 @@
 				 "application/octet-stream")
 			   "text/plain")))
 	       (charset (cdr (assq 'charset cont)))
-	       (coding (mm-charset-to-coding-system charset))
+	       (coding (let (mm-charset-eval-alist mm-charset-synonym-alist)
+			 (mm-charset-to-coding-system charset)))
 	       encoding flowed coded)
+	  (unless coding
+	    (error "Unknown charset: %s" charset))
 	  (cond ((eq coding 'ascii)
 		 (setq charset nil
 		       coding nil))
--8<---------------cut here---------------end--------------->8---

Patch2:
--8<---------------cut here---------------start------------->8---
--- mml.el~	2008-10-03 05:47:11 +0000
+++ mml.el	2008-10-20 23:58:29 +0000
@@ -482,7 +482,12 @@
 		 (setq charset nil
 		       coding nil))
 		(charset
-		 (setq charset (intern (downcase charset)))))
+		 ;; `charset' might be an alias that `mm-charset-synonym-alist'
+		 ;; provides and might not be in common use, so we prefer
+		 ;; the one that Emacs knows for `coding'.
+		 (setq charset (if coding
+				   (mm-coding-system-to-mime-charset coding)
+				 (intern (downcase charset))))))
 	  (if (and (not raw)
 		   (member (car (split-string type "/")) '("text" "message")))
 	      (progn
--8<---------------cut here---------------end--------------->8---
